The Importance Of Free Independent Pension Advice
As individuals, planning for retirement is an essential aspect of securing our financial future. However, navigating through the complexities of pension plans and options can be overwhelming and confusing. This is where free independent pension advice comes into play. By seeking advice from professionals who are not affiliated with any particular pension provider, individuals can make informed decisions about their retirement savings and investments.
One of the primary benefits of seeking free independent pension advice is the unbiased nature of the information provided. When working with a financial advisor who is tied to a specific pension provider, there is always a risk of receiving advice that is skewed in favor of that provider’s products. On the other hand, independent advisors are not restricted by such conflicts of interest and can offer recommendations that are truly in the best interest of their clients.
Furthermore, free independent pension advice can help individuals understand the various pension options available to them. From workplace pensions to personal pensions and self-invested personal pensions (SIPPs), the world of retirement savings can be complex and overwhelming. Independent advisors have the expertise to explain the differences between these options and help individuals choose the one that aligns with their financial goals and risk tolerance.
In addition, free independent pension advice can also provide individuals with valuable insights into the tax implications of their pension choices. Different pension plans come with varying tax benefits and consequences, and it is crucial to understand how these factors can impact one’s retirement income. Independent advisors can help individuals optimize their pension contributions to maximize tax efficiency and minimize any potential tax liabilities.
